After reading Most Likely to Succeed, I began thinking about all of the other resources I’ve read lately about the future of learning and the re-imagination that is required to redesign the education system. Since it is a topic that is very important to me I decided to make a Most Likely to Succeed Video Book Review that highlighted my own educational philosophy.. In order to make it interesting and to tie in some of the additional resources I have been reading, I decided to use footage from other videos. I hope that I changed the content enough and gave enough credit to the sources, that this work is merely a compilation of ideas. Not an attempt to take credit for any of the original work. This is a Remixed media that acknowledges the original work, gives credit to the original work and merely tries to bolster the important message for the sake of our education system.
